In this paper, we propose a data-driven approach for realistic deformation of articulated meshes: the wide availability of pose data makes such an approach feasible. We use multiple reference models, combined with a fast linear blending skinning (LBS) method in local spaces. By exploiting information from the reference models, realistic deformation is achieved, yet with computational efficiency comparable to traditional blending methods-our approach is suitable for real-time applications. We demonstrate the effectiveness of our algorithm using various examples. |
